    the transmission has gone out on my father in laws 2003 impala. it has a 4t65e in it and I have a spare transmission out of my 2001 gtp. the impala either has a 3.05 or a 3.29 gear ratio, but the gtp has a 2.93. I am wondering if someone could write a dhp bin file for a stock 2003 impala with the correct gear ratio conversion. I will have my father in law look at his car and find out which final drive ratio it has.

    Marshal - you have a dhp and all the files you should need. Open your fathers car's file and a file with 2.93's. Then simply copy the trans over from the 2.93 car to the Impala. Poof.. you are all set, although you might want to consider adjusting the shift points. Take a look at the most current file in 2000 Regal under Bostick. That's the one i'm using with 2.93's on an NA motor.
